Each franchise will offer trading terminals in English and local languages (already enabled in most cases). The terminals
(and global system) will establish liquidity in products that are traded globally, as well as products that are traded locally.
In addition, it puts us in a position to to capitalize on local order flow distribution channels that leverage each
EFTA01030071
jurisdictions particular regulatory framework for broker dealers, future commissions merchants, FX platforms and other
participants. My experience in global markets has taught me that while the prices for a given commodity can largely be
global, the participation in liquidity remains a relative local phenomenon driven by relationships and regional nuances
(like language, regulatory principles, tax regimes, etc.). This particularly applies to Bank Secrecy Act regulation and
limitations. While most of these countries are either directly or indirectly involved in FATF the actual boots on the
ground application of these principles varies significantly from region to region. The application of our concept therefore
aggregates global liquidity pools extremely efficiently while respecting each jurisdiction regulatory requirements —
including, and especially, the United States.
The secret sauce to the franchise concept is aggregating each unique regional pool of liquidity into an effective singular
pool of liquidity using extremely advanced and proprietary features of our match engine (briefly discussed with The
Prof).
